Start by preparing your glass. Brush the rim of a rocks glass with agave syrup, then dip it into a small plate of sea salt to coat evenly. Set the glass aside.
In a cocktail shaker, add three jalapeño slices, Pineapple & Jalapeño Tequila, guava syrup, pineapple juice, coconut cream, and lime juice.
Shake the mixture vigorously to ensure all the flavors are well-blended and the ingredients are chilled.
Strain the mixture into the prepared rocks glass filled with fresh ice.
Garnish the cocktail with the remaining two jalapeño slices for an extra spicy kick.
Serve and enjoy your Spicy Guava Pineapple Margarita!

Pro Tips:
Adjust the spiciness by adding or reducing the number of jalapeño slices.
Use freshly squeezed lime juice for the best flavor.
For a smokier taste, try using a charred jalapeño slice as a garnish.
Chill your glass in the freezer before prepping to keep your drink colder for longer.
